Budget Allocation Discussions

  • 🎯 Secretary Linda McMahon stated that the Department of Education is still considering how to spend all of its congressionally allocated budget.
  • ⚠️ This comes amid concerns from Senator Tammy Baldwin regarding unallocated funds, including $1.3 billion for before and after school programs and over $2 billion for teacher training.

Unallocated Funds and Their Impact

  • 💰 McMahon acknowledged that over $8 billion remains unallocated according to the department's own assessment.
  • 💡 Senator Baldwin expressed that not spending these funds represents a decision not to invest in children, with specific mention of funds for Wisconsin's students and educators.
  • 📚 The unallocated funds include significant amounts for evidence-based professional learning for educators and addressing teacher access gaps.

Confirmation Hearing Promises vs. Current Actions

  • 🗣️ Senator Baldwin referenced McMahon's confirmation hearing statement that appropriated funds "should be disseminated".
  • ❓ Baldwin questioned whether McMahon would allocate all congressionally appropriated funding, implying a potential withholding of funds.
  • 🤝 McMahon indicated a desire to continue working with Congress to evaluate programs and allocations.
